Quick Answer

The best vegan egg substitutes are Flax Eggs, Chia Eggs, Aquafaba, and Commercial Vegan Egg Replacers. These provide binding, moisture, and leavening without any animal products.

Best Substitutes

Flax Eggs

1 egg = 1 tbsp ground flaxseed + 3 tbsp water

Made by mixing ground flaxseed with water to create a gel-like binding agent. Rich in omega-3 fatty acids and fiber.

Best for:

Mix and let sit for 5 minutes until thickened. Adds nutty flavor and provides excellent binding properties.

Chia Eggs

1 egg = 1 tbsp chia seeds + 3 tbsp water

Similar to flax eggs but with smaller seeds. Creates a gel that binds ingredients together with minimal flavor impact.

Let mixture sit for 10 minutes to form gel. Chia seeds are smaller and less noticeable in final product than flax.

Aquafaba

1 egg = 3 tbsp aquafaba (chickpea liquid)

The liquid from canned chickpeas that can be whipped like egg whites. Perfect for meringues, mousses, and light baked goods.

Whip aquafaba with a mixer until it forms stiff peaks. Works best when chilled before whipping.

Commercial Vegan Egg Replacer

1 egg = 1 tsp powder + 2 tbsp water

Powdered mix designed specifically for vegan baking. Provides consistent results for binding and leavening.

Follow package instructions. Mix powder with water before adding to recipe. Best for leavening and binding.

Silken Tofu

1 egg = 1/4 cup blended silken tofu

Blended silken tofu provides moisture and binding. Works well in dense baked goods and creamy recipes.

Blend silken tofu until smooth before using. Adds protein and creates a creamy texture.

Applesauce

1 egg = 1/4 cup applesauce

Adds moisture and helps bind ingredients. Makes baked goods denser and moister.

Use unsweetened applesauce to avoid extra sugar. Makes baked goods denser and moister.

Cooking Tips

  • 💡For vegan baking, flax and chia eggs are the most reliable binding agents
  • 💡Aquafaba is perfect for recipes that need whipped egg whites
  • 💡Silken tofu works best in creamy, dense recipes like cheesecakes
  • 💡Commercial vegan egg replacers provide the most consistent results
  • 💡Always let flax and chia eggs sit for the full time to thicken properly
  • 💡For recipes requiring multiple eggs, consider using a combination of substitutes
  • 💡Test your substitute in a small batch first to ensure proper texture

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the best vegan egg substitute for scrambled eggs?

For scrambled eggs, try crumbled firm tofu seasoned with turmeric, black salt (kala namak), and nutritional yeast. Sauté with vegetables and seasonings for a convincing scrambled egg texture and flavor.

Can I use aquafaba in all vegan baking recipes?

Aquafaba works best in recipes that need whipped egg whites, like meringues or light cakes. For binding in cookies or muffins, flax or chia eggs work better.

How do I make vegan deviled eggs?

Use halved boiled potatoes or hollowed-out cucumber slices as the base. Fill with a mixture of mashed avocado, mustard, and seasonings, or use a tofu-based filling for a more traditional texture.

What's the best vegan substitute for eggs in pancakes?

Flax eggs or chia eggs work best for pancakes as they provide the binding properties needed. You can also use 1/4 cup applesauce per egg for a slightly denser pancake.

Can I use commercial egg replacers for all vegan recipes?

Commercial vegan egg replacers work well for most baking recipes, but they may not work for recipes that need whipped egg whites. For those, use aquafaba instead.
